priceless
Senso (Inglese)
- (literally, not-comparable, rare) Without a price assigned; unpriced.
- (broadly, literally, not-comparable) So precious as not to be obtainable or sold at any price.
- (archaic, broadly, literally, not-comparable) Of no value; valueless; worthless.
- (comparable, figuratively) Held in high regard; treasured.
- (comparable, figuratively, informal) Absurd; ridiculous.
- (comparable, figuratively, informal) Very amusing; hilarious.
- (comparable, figuratively, informal, ironic, often) Excellent; fantastic; wonderful.

Etimologia (Inglese)
From price + -less (“lacking, without”).
